Hello! While working with iwfi drivers in Haiku (those drivers are ported from
FreeBSD) i founded the bugs, that potentially is FreeBSD specific.

iprowifi4965 and iprowifi3945 are affected. May be others.

I will describe them on iprowifi4965 code.

iwn_tx_done has KASSERT(data->ni != NULL, ("no node")) at beginning that is
triggers in some situations. 

The situation can be:

1) hw interrupt is scheduled

2) iwn_hw_stop is called (and it disables/enables interrupss) node is destroyed
here.

3) here we got scheduled (threaded) interrupt that is not actual anymore ->
panic

In fact, i was thinking it is Haiku specific bug, because of threaded inr
handlers. But i found this bug report and it seems the same for me.

To reproduce it on Haiku i run floodping to roater while reboot the system. But
on FreeBSD i am not sure, what can couse iwn_hw_stop while sending packets...

Hope it helps.
